Unix quick reference man shows help on a specific command pwd print name of currentworking directory ls show directory, in alphabetical order logout logs off system mkdir make a directory rmdir remove directory rm remove files rm r remove folder with files mv move a file. As a command interpreter, the shell provides the user interface to the rich set of gnu utilities. Vim quick reference nathan lay january 9, 2008 1 introduction vi is a text editor that originated in bsd unix in the mid 1970s. Learning to use vim commands is a matter of practice and experience. Before you run vi each time you connect to a central uits computer to use vi, you need to set your terminal type. File and directory names can be mixedcase but always must be typed exactly as named. An introduction to display editing with vi play psych mun. Unix tool box an incredibly exhaustive reference for all things linux treebeards unix cheat sheet a great reference with dos comparisons. While this is applicable to both vi and vim editors, i dont prefer using these weird keycombinations. Command description pwd prints working directory prints to screen, ie displays the full path, or your location on the filesystem ls lists contents of current directory ls l lists contents of current directory with extra details ls homeuser. Learn about the default text editor, vi, pronounced as vee eye, in unix, linux and other unix.
Vi quick reference there is also a printable, pdf version of the quick reference card. Insert mode in which entered text is inserted into the file. Its one of the most efficient editors ever created although maybe not one of the most userfriendly ones. When the vi editor was first developed, most keyboards didnt have arrow keys. A unix shell is both a command interpreter and a programming language. The default editor that comes with the unix operating system is called vi visual editor. Command description pwd prints working directory prints to screen, ie displays the full path, or your location on the filesystem ls lists contents of current directory ls l lists contents of current directory with extra details. A quick reference list of vi editor commands this content has been archived, and is no longer maintained by indiana university. Jun 14, 2017 unix and linux commands cheat sheet command reference examples pdf vi vim editor commands cheat sheet command reference examples pdf this website used to be called, which is why you see that name on the bottom of the cheat sheets. Fullscreen text editors like vi, emacs, and pico enable you to create and edit text files, such as program code. X windows managers, text editors, sending and receiving electronic mail, and networking.
Streamoriented, noninteractive, text editor look for patterns one line at a time, like grep change lines of the file noninteractive text editor editing commands come in as script there is an interactive editor ed which accepts the same commands a unix filter superset of previously mentioned tools. Sep 26, 2020 check this onepage cheat sheet that will help you get back to work quickly and improve your velocity while working in vi vim. Starting with the unix shell and moving steadily deeper inside the unix environment, unix for dummies quick reference, 4th edition, cuts to the. Unix porting commands external oracle and virtual environments. Screen terminal emulator cheat sheet pdf cheat sheet for screen.
Quick reference guide for the vi text editor practical. In case vi is not able to understand the term you have given, it starts in open mode giving you a line by line display. Create free account to access unlimited books, fast download and ads free. The editor begins in command mode, where cursor movement and text deletion and pasting occur. Now a days you would find an improved version of vi editor which is called vim. Information here may no longer be accurate, and links may no longer be available or reliable. This is a quick vim reference, it takes you through the things that you should know. Vi cheat sheet linux terminal cheat sheet pdf smashing. We really appreciate your work and your good intentions. Return returns you to the last saved version of the file, so you can start over. The vi editor is available on all uits unix computers. Directories mkdir directoryname make a new directory. Basic vim commands every linux user must know with pdf. Basic vim commands every linux user must know with pdf cheat.
Step by step instructions on setting up an iscsi san on a linux system. Esc returns the editor to command mode where you can quit, for example by typing. The key to effective vim use is to spot the symmetries that often exist in the commands. A quick reference list of vi editor commands iu knowledge base. Commonly used term types are vt100, vt220 and ansi. If your file has been modified in any way, the editor will warn. Redirection routes output from command to file appends output to. May 03, 2010 so we put together the vi cheat sheet that can be used for quick reference as and when you need. You may be interested in the following related posts. Each time a different command is to be entered, the escape key needs to be used. All the best linux cheat sheets tue, apr 7, 2009 1. Once in input mode, any character you type is taken to be text and is added to the file.
Linux admin quick reference pdf the one page linux manual pdf unix command translator. Common unix printing system cups is the default printing system on many linux distros and mac osx. Unix reference card warnings when a file has been deleted it can only be restored from a backup. Vi editor linux terminal cheat sheet pdf smashing magazine. Files and directories on unix, information is stored in files and directories.
Once in command mode, type colon, and q, followed by return. At indiana university, for personal or departmental linux or unix systems support, see get help for linux or unix at iu. A quick reference to commonly used commands is listed on the reverse side of this brochure. Screen quick reference quick reference to a must have screen emulator, also check out introduction to gnu screen. Regular expressions cheat sheet by dave child davechild via 1cs5 anchors start of string, or start of line in multiline pattern. In order to work correctly the vi need correct terminal type term setting depending on the type of terminal you have. So we put together the vi cheat sheet that can be used for quick reference. This quick reference lists commands you can use in the vi editor on.
We cannot guarantee that unix quick reference book is in the library. Command mode commands which cause action to be taken on the file, and. Click to download and print vi editor cheat sheet in pdf format. The programming language features allow these utilities to be combined. Alternate editors for unix environments include pico and emacs, a product of gnu. Recover filename that was being edited when system crashed.
Unix quick reference this card represents a brief summary of some of the more frequently used unix commands that all users should be at least somewhat familiar with. Forgetting a command here or there can really break up their workflow. One page linux manual great one page reference to the most popular linux commands. Be used after unix listing projects by prasanna chandra pdf download commands such as ls or cat filename to display information one screen. It was meant as a replacement to ed, a more limited text editor. List of useful vi commands to improve proficiency in this tool for the unix linux environment open vi guide. You switch vi to input mode by entering any one of several vi input commands.
All commands in vi are preceded by pressing the escape key. The unix vi editor is a full screen editor and has two modes of operation. Aug 03, 2018 vi vim purists will suggest using h, j, k and l keys for moving up, left, right and down respectively when you are in the command mode. The positioning commands operate only while vi is in command mode. Invoked from input mode or last line mode by pressing the esc key. The older unix vi editor is much the same but does not do all that vim does. Unix for dummies quick reference, 4th edition, clues you in to the most popular and essential parts of unix. Pdf unix quick reference download full ebooks for free. Vi editor cheat sheet movement commands character h, j, k, l left, down, up, right text w, w, b, b forward, backward by word e, e end of word, beginning of next, previous sentence. Linux unix command line cheat sheet gettinggeneticsdone. Directory abbreviations home directory tilde username another users home directory. A few features to get you started with unix are described below.
Insertion mode begins upon entering an insertion or change command. It was created back in 2007 but even after 11 years, this command reference sheet is equally helpful. Unlike ed, vi is a full screen editor featuring numerous commands to copypaste and otherwise manipulate text. Starting with the unix shell and moving steadily deeper inside the unix environment, unix for dummies quick reference, 4th edition, cuts to the chase with clear, concise answers to all your unix questions. Aug 12, 2018 unix linux command reference from fosswire this is one the most popular linux command cheat sheets on the internet.
Lists the type of unix, whether system v, sun os, or bsd. Files containing commands can be created, and become commands themselves. Its usually available on all the flavors of unix system. The editor begins in command mode, where cursor move ment and text. Linux reference card great reference published on fosswire website. Quick reference guide for the vi text editor moving the cursor in vi hjkl leftdownupright may be preceded by a repeat count 0 start of line f forward one screen selection from practical unix book.
Some commands listed have much more functionality than can be included on this card. Quick reference guide for the vi text editor practical unix. To make this easy here is the vi editor cheat sheet in pdf format which can be printed, shared and used for ready reference. Attached to this document should be a quick reference card. Its implementations are very similar across the board. Vi now displays the file buffer with the changes in place. The vim vi improved book pdf, 572 pages unix text processing by dale dougherty, tim oreilly pdf, pbm a tutorial introduction to gnu emacs by chicago state university. You cannot execute any commands until you exit input mode. For example, its available on virtually every unix or unix like system. Type commands demonstrated on this reference card exactly as shown. Click get books and find your favorite books in the online library. At iub, your software will typically emulate a vt100 terminal. Download full unix quick reference book or read online anytime anywhere, available in pdf, epub and kindle.
1050 922 418 1711 367 382 856 1295 1086 882 1239 537 1088 1344 1753 252 1235 464 696 822 1131 408 194 231 1736 458 1744